| Reverse description | Crowned imperial double-headed eagle displayed with wings spread, bearing on its breast a circular imperial orb containing the denomination numeral 30. The eagle, symbol of the Holy Roman Empire, is rendered in the late Renaissance heraldic style typical of issues struck under Emperor Rudolf II. A circular legend surrounds the design. |
| Reverse script | Log in to see details |
| Reverse lettering | RVDOL II IMP AVGVS P F DECRETO 30 (Translation: Rudolph II, emperor august, by decree [of the Empire].) |
